One of the first places I went to after migrating to Australia from Scotland were the Glass House Mountains in Queensland.
I was blown away by the magnitude of the space, it seemed to go on forever into the distance. A visual shock in the best way, expansive skies, hard shadows and land stretching outwards. Huge impact.
The colours in this work are saturated, almost surreal like a Sci Fi movie set, I found the whole place inspiring. I also used ripped calico on the board for textural effect.
A partner piece to Mt Coonowrin/Mt Beerwah from my show; HOME/land which was at Field Trip Gallery , Paddington Brisbane in October this year
